Skills, Knowledge/Experience Required to perform the job
College diploma in Industrial Maintenance, Mechanical Engineering Technician, Electromechanical Engineering Technician, Millwright, Industrial Electrician, Building Systems Technician, or a related field.
Electrical Knowledge:
· Knowledge of industrial electrical systems, motors, VFDs, sensors, relays, and control panels.
· Ability to troubleshoot electrical faults safely.
· Ability to read and interpret electrical schematics and wiring diagrams.
· Experience using multimeters and electrical testing equipment.
· Understanding of electrical codes and safety standards.
Mechanical Knowledge:
· Knowledge of conveyors, pumps, gearboxes, bearings, pneumatic systems, and hydraulic systems. ·
Ability to perform preventative and predictive maintenance.
· Strong troubleshooting and root cause analysis skills.
· Ability to read and interpret mechanical drawings and equipment manuals.
· Experience with machine repairs, alignment, lubrication systems, and power transmission components.
Food Manufacturing Experience (Preferred)
· Previous experience working in a food manufacturing or GMP environment.
· Understanding of sanitation requirements and food safety regulations.
· Experience minimizing production downtime through effective maintenance planning.
